Handover: Linkwell deep-link routing (from Priya-era setup). Plugin authors register URI patterns against the Linkwell router; matching is longest-prefix, evaluated before the fallback web view. Unregistered schemes bounce to the store page, which surprises people. Before writing a handler, please verify your pattern against the router's current configuration values, listed below.

deployment values, yadup-kadug:
[sorys]
port = 5672
team = noveth
host = sorys.orvexcorp.example
region = south-4
access_code = ac_deddc1
timeout_ms = 1500

Snapshot testing primer for Larkbay UI. Components under /components have stored snapshots; any visual change fails CI until snapshots are regenerated with the update script. Never bulk-approve updates — review diffs one by one. Support triage: if a customer reports layout glitches, check whether the latest release included snapshot updates for that component. The snapshot diff service is internal; authenticate your requests with the key below.

API key for yahig-tadup: kto7_ubizbYm

**Vendor note: Inkmill markdown pipeline**

Rendering for Parchway docs is outsourced to Inkmill under an annual contract, renewing each March. They handle sanitization and PDF export; we own the upload queue. SLA: 4-hour response on rendering failures. Escalate only after two failed retries. Their support desk is reachable at the address below.

billing contact of hahaf-baguf = zorael.tammir.jorius@sivrelhq.internal

Cron migration to Tidewheel

All nightly crons move to the Tidewheel workflow engine this release. Legacy crontabs on the batch hosts get disabled, not deleted, until two clean runs. Each migrated job needs a Tidewheel spec plus an owner tag. Register specs through the ingest endpoint before cutover. The endpoint authenticates with the internal key that follows.

service key, fawip-bajef: kto11_Qt5wZK9vdNC